Analysis

California engineering graduates typically command strong salaries, with the state median at $87,724—making the estimated $67,911 first-year figure for Cal State East Bay graduates notably lower than what peer programs in California deliver. While these estimates come from national benchmarks rather than East Bay's actual outcomes, the $20,000 gap between these projections and state norms is meaningful, especially when UC Davis and Harvey Mudd graduates routinely clear $80,000-plus in their first year.

The estimated debt of $25,832 aligns closely with national engineering program norms and stays well below the concerning 1.0 debt-to-earnings threshold at 0.38. For a school serving a substantial population of Pell grant recipients (44%), this accessibility matters—engineering credentials that don't saddle graduates with crushing debt provide genuine social mobility. However, the earnings gap persists: if these estimates prove accurate, East Bay graduates would be starting $15,000-20,000 behind their California counterparts, which compounds significantly over a career.

The core question is whether East Bay can match the performance of other California engineering programs despite its near-open admission. Without actual graduate outcomes, you're making an informed bet that this specific program delivers results comparable to the national median rather than California's stronger state average. Given the accessibility and reasonable debt load, it's a defensible choice if California's pricier alternatives aren't options—but recognize you may be trading some earning potential for that accessibility.

About This Data

Source: U.S. Department of Education College Scorecard (October 2025 release)

Population: Graduates who received federal financial aid (Title IV grants or loans). At California State University-East Bay, approximately 44% of students receive Pell grants. Students who did not receive federal aid are not included in these figures.

Earnings: Median earnings from IRS W-2 data for graduates who are employed and not enrolled in further education, measured 1 year after completion. Earnings are pre-tax and include wages, salaries, and self-employment income.

Debt: Median cumulative federal loan debt at graduation. Does not include private loans or Parent PLUS loans borrowed on behalf of students.

Estimated Earnings: Actual earnings data is not available for this program (typically due to privacy thresholds when fewer than 30 graduates reported earnings). The estimate shown is based on the national median of 47 similar programs. Actual outcomes may vary.
